‘Hear For It’: Philippines Embraces its Inaugural Podcast Festival



The Philippines is set to host its first-ever podcast festival, Hear For It, bringing together talented creators, experienced producers, and enthusiastic fans to unite the thriving local podcast community. The event will take place at the Glorietta Palm Drive Activity Center on Friday, October 20th, from 10:30 a.m. to 8 p.m. Admission is free for everyone.

Hear For It will feature an impressive lineup of the country’s most beloved podcast personalities, including Bianca Gonzalez of Paano Ba ‘To, directors Antoinette Jadaone and JP Habac of Ang Walang Kwentang Podcast, real-life couple Jim Baccaro and Saab Magalona of Wake Up with Jim & Saab, host and comedian Victor Anastacio of Intellectwalwal, creative Ali Sangalang of The Linya-Linya Show, GB Labrador, James Caraan, Nonong Ballinan and the crew at The Kool Pals, DJ Joelle of Paano Kung…, Roanne and Tina of Queertuhan, and many others.

Festival-goers can expect a variety of activities at Hear For It, including curated listening pods featuring various podcast titles, thought-provoking discussions with influential voices in podcasting, opportunities to connect with fellow enthusiasts and industry experts, hands-on workshops on content creation, production, marketing, and monetization, and the chance to meet their favorite podcasters and share the excitement on social media. Select fans will also receive exclusive boxes with limited-edition merchandise and exciting goodies from event partners.

The festival is powered by ANIMA Podcasts and co-presented by Globe and Kroma Entertainment, in partnership with Spotify and The Pod Network, and sponsored by YOU Beauty, with Ayala Malls as the official venue partner.
